Little Italy

Part of the Greater Montreal metropolitan area, Little Italy is a neighbourhood within Montréal, Quebec.

Transportation

Little Italy is an excellent neighbourhood with regards to getting around without driving. The great public transit infrastructure allows people to get to many destinations without needing a car. Property owners benefit from a few bus lines, and most homes are very close to a bus stop. It is also very easy for people travelling on foot to get around in this part of the city; most day-to-day errands can be run without the use of a vehicle, and plenty of businesses are reasonably nearby. Active people will enjoy the especially cycling-friendly nature of Little Italy. In particular, the bicycling infrastructure is quite extensive, and cyclists do not encounter significant elevation changes.

Services

Daycares and schools are straightforward to get to on foot from most properties for sale in this part of the city. In terms of food, it is very easy to access both a general and a specialty grocery store by walking from any location in this area. There are approximately 10 supermarkets in this part of Montréal, and the best variety can be found on streets such as Boulevard Saint-Laurent. Additionally, those who like to eat out won't have to walk far in Little Italy, where over 50 restaurants and a few cafes are available. It is also especially easy to get to a number of clothing stores on foot.

Character

No matter what type of character home buyers prefer in a neighbourhood, Little Italy is a good option. Little Italy is reasonably quiet, as the streets tend to be quite tranquil, however noise can be problematic near the railway line. There is a fair amount of greenery in this neighbourhood as most streets have good tree coverage. Public green spaces are very easy to access since there are a few of them close by for residents to relax in. Finally, finding vibrant areas is very easy in this neighbourhood. There are a very large number of people around most of the time, there are many nearby entertainment venues, and with its about 10 nightlife venues, there are options for nighttime activities. Main streets, such as Rue Jean-Talon, are very good for those who like going out.

Housing

In Little Italy, the vast majority of dwellings are small apartment buildings, while the rest are mainly duplexes. This part of the city offers mainly two bedroom and one bedroom homes. Renters occupy about 70% of the units in Little Italy and 30% are occupied by owners. This area experienced its main construction boom pre-1960, so most of the available homes are from this time period.
